打包为apk
打包为apk是Android应用程序的最终步骤,也是将应用程序交付给用户的关键步骤。在此过程中,所有应用程序资源,包括代码、图像、音频和其他文件,都将被编译、压缩和打包为一个单独的文件,即apk文件。在本文中,我们将详细介绍打包为apk的原理和步骤。一、打包为apk的原理打包为apk的原理是将所有应...
2023-12-09 围观 : 0次
域名封装APP是一种将域名封装为APP的技术,可以将一个域名封装成一个APP,用户可以通过APP访问该域名所对应的网站,从而实现更加方便、快捷的访问体验。下面将对域名封装APP的原理和详细介绍进行介绍。
一、域名封装APP的原理
域名封装APP的原理主要是通过将域名封装成一个APP,在APP中内置Webview控件,用户可以通过APP访问该域名所对应的网站。具体实现步骤如下:
1. 获取域名信息:首先需要获取该域名所对应的IP地址和端口号等信息。
2. 构建APP框架:在APP中内置Webview控件,用于显示网页内容。同时,还需要添加一些功能模块,如导航栏、底部菜单栏、推送通知等,以提高用户体验。
3. 配置域名信息:将获取到的域名信息配置到APP中,确保用户可以通过APP访问该域名所对应的网站。
4. 封装APP:将构建好的APP打包成安装包,发布到应用商店或官网供用户下载安装。
二、域名封装APP的详细介绍
1. 优点
(1)提高用户体验:通过将域名封装成APP,可以为用户提供更加方便、快捷的访问体验,避免了用户需要打开浏览器、输入网址等繁琐的操作步骤。
(2)提高网站流量:通过封装域名成APP,可以提高网站的流量和曝光率,从而提高网站的知名度和影响力。
(3)提高用户黏性:通过内置一些功能模块,如导航栏、底部菜单栏、推送通知等,可以提高用户的黏性,增强用户对该网站的依赖和信任。
2. 缺点
(1)需要开发和维护APP:封装域名成APP需要进行开发和维护,需要投入一定的人力和物力成本。
(2)存在安全隐患:由于APP中内置Webview控件,可能存在一些安全隐患,如XSS攻击、CSRF攻击等。
(3)存在兼容性问题:由于不同的移动设备和操作系统之间存在差异,可能会存在兼容性问题,需要进行适配和测试。
3. 应用场景
(1)企业官网:企业可以将自己的官网封装成APP,方便员工和客户进行访问和交流。
(2)电商平台:电商平台可以将自己的网站封装成APP,提供更加便捷的购物体验,同时也可以增加用户黏性和转化率。
(3)新闻资讯:新闻资讯网站可以将自己的网站封装成APP,提供更加方便、快捷的新闻阅读体验。
总之,域名封装APP是一种将域名封装为APP的技术,可以提高用户体验、网站流量和用户黏性,但也存在一些缺点和安全隐患。需要根据具体的应用场景进行选择和使用。
打包为apk是Android应用程序的最终步骤,也是将应用程序交付给用户的关键步骤。在此过程中,所有应用程序资源,包括代码、图像、音频和其他文件,都将被编译、压缩和打包为一个单独的文件,即apk文件。在本文中,我们将详细介绍打包为apk的原理和步骤。一、打包为apk的原理打包为apk的原理是将所有应...
市场开发策略是指推广一款产品或服务的方法和计划,以吸引目标用户并提高销售业绩。对于App来说,市场开发策略是一项非常重要的事情,因为市场竞争激烈,用户需求也在不断变换,只有通过正确的市场开发策略才能够占据一席之地。在开发App的市场推广策略时需要考虑的最重要的因素是目标用户。需要确定目标用户群体的性...
EXE打包APK的原理是将Windows应用程序(.exe)转换为Android应用程序(.apk),从而使Windows应用程序能够在Android设备上运行。下面将详细介绍EXE打包APK的原理和步骤。首先,需要了解的是EXE和APK的区别。EXE是Windows操作系统下的可执行文件,而APK...
网页App,即Web App,是使用Web技术编写的应用程序,表现形式类似于传统的桌面应用程序或移动App,但是不需要下载和安装,只需要使用浏览器访问即可。它融合了Web和移动应用程序的优点,具有跨平台、快速迭代、灵活性和可扩展性等优势,因此越来越受到开发者和用户的青睐。Web App的主要原理是利...
Vue是一个JavaScript框架,用于构建用户界面,提供了一些数据驱动的特性,包括组件化和单文件组件等。因此,Vue并不属于安卓软件,而是一种用于Web开发的技术。Vue的设计目标是尽可能简单和易学,同时也是高效和灵活的,它可以与其他库和工具(如Webpack)结合使用,也可以用于构建单页应用程...